What South Fulton code requires

Replacing a water heater in South Fulton follows Georgia rules under the International Plumbing Code (IPC) with Georgia state amendments. Here’s what applies statewide:

  • Permit

    Pulled by your licensed plumber; covers gas/venting and the expansion tank.

    Required
  • Seismic strapping

    No state strapping mandate — one less line on the bill.

    Not required
  • Expansion tank

    Required where a pressure regulator or backflow preventer is present.

    Required on closed systems
  • Plumbing code
    International Plumbing Code (IPC) with Georgia state amendments
  • Good to know

    On a replacement install, a drain pan is not required where one was not previously installed; otherwise units must be third-party certified and accessible for service.

What moves the price

Why Water Heater Replacement Costs Vary in South Fulton

Prices differ based on unit type: tank gas ($900–$2,300), tank electric ($1,050–$2,500), tankless ($1,750–$4,000+), and heat pump ($2,100–$4,600). Labor rates reflect local market conditions. Permits add a fee. If an expansion tank is needed for a closed system, that adds cost. A drain pan is only required if one was previously installed. The 25C tax credit can offset heat pump costs by up to $2,000.

What to expect

What to Expect During a Water Heater Replacement in South Fulton

A licensed plumber will obtain the required permit and disconnect the old unit. They'll install the new water heater, ensuring it's third-party certified and accessible. An expansion tank will be added if your system is closed. The job typically takes 2–4 hours. After installation, they'll test for leaks and proper operation.
